accurately estimate

准确地估计

频率: 8.217.5 每百万词

To estimate something correctly or with precision.

正确或精确地估计某事。

例句 (10)

accurately estimate = 准确地估计 (正确或精确地估计某事。)

  • It's difficult to accurately estimate the total cost of the project at this early stage.在这么早的阶段,很难准确估算项目的总成本。
  • Using the latest satellite data, scientists can now more accurately estimate crop yields.利用最新的卫星数据,科学家现在能更准确估算农作物产量。
  • The survey was designed to accurately estimate the number of unemployed people in the region.这项调查旨在准确估算该地区失业人口的数量。
  • She prided herself on being able to accurately estimate how long any task would take.她为自己能够准确估算任何任务所需的时间而自豪。
  • Without more information, we cannot accurately estimate the potential risks involved.没有更多信息,我们无法准确估算所涉及的潜在风险。
  • The financial model has been updated to accurately estimate future earnings.该财务模型已更新,以便准确估算未来收益。
  • Historians still find it challenging to accurately estimate the population of ancient Rome.历史学家仍然觉得准确估算古罗马的人口具有挑战性。
  • By analyzing traffic patterns, the system accurately estimates travel time.通过分析交通模式,该系统可以准确估算出行时间。
  • Accurately estimating the amount of paint needed is key to staying on budget.准确估算所需油漆量是保持在预算内的关键。
  • The damage from the earthquake was accurately estimated by the insurance adjusters.保险理算员准确估算了地震造成的损失。
